Officer was fired, if you read the story associated with the video.
Honestly it doesn't matter if a citizen is being a jerk; officers of the law are paid and trained to be calm and patient, and to enforce the law and only the law, within strict guidelines and according to well defined practices and procedures. Its their job, and if they don't do their job, they can be fired (and probably will be).
Its no different than say, a day care worker screaming at a crying child. That is unacceptable, the day care worker's job is to behave in a certain way around the children that they care for, every day, regardless of how that child behaves. There are strict rules about how that day care worker enforces and sets rules, and society holds them accountable.
Sorry if cops have to deal with jerks all day, but if you can't handle that, then its the wrong job to be in.KR
